Step-by-step explanation:
These problems rely on your knowledge of the side ratios of special triangles
45°-45°-90° triangle: 1 : 1 : √2
30°-60°-90° triangle: 1 : √3 : 2
__
17) 5 is the short side of the isosceles right triangle, so its hypotenuse is 5√2. That length is the shortest side of the 30/60/90 triangle, so its longest side is 2 times that:
x = 10√2
__
18) 8 is the longest side of the 30/60/90 triangle, so its long leg will be 8(√3)/2 = 4√3. The hypotenuse of the isosceles right triangle is √2 times that, so ...
x = (4√3)(√2)
x = 4√6
